Launching a Sportsbook

A sportsbook is a gambling establishment that accepts bets on sporting events and pays out winnings. It offers a variety of betting options, including proposition bets and exotic bets. The odds on a particular event are determined by the sportsbook’s bookmakers and are usually calculated using the probability of an outcome. Oftentimes, sportsbooks use point-spreads or moneyline odds to balance the risk on each side of a wager, while simultaneously collecting 4.5% in vig, or the house’s profit margin. The goal is to attract bettors and encourage them to make more wagers.

Sportsbooks have a number of different rules that they follow when it comes to accepting bets. Some of them offer their customers money back when they lose a bet against the spread, while others have specific criteria for determining whether a bet is a winner or not. Regardless of how these rules are set up, the main purpose is to ensure that bettors have a positive experience.

A good sportsbook should have a high-quality UI that runs smoothly and without any problems on most devices. This will increase user satisfaction and keep them coming back. It’s also important to have a robust payment system that supports multiple currencies and payment methods. This will help users avoid any potential currency fluctuations and make the process of placing a bet as simple as possible.

When launching a sportsbook, it’s important to understand the legal landscape and consult with a lawyer to make sure that your company is in compliance with all relevant laws. You’ll also need to find a reliable software provider that can accommodate your budget and offer the features you need for your sportsbook.

While many people are familiar with the concept of a sportsbook, they might not know exactly what it is or how it works. A sportsbook is a place where you can make bets on a range of sporting events, from football matches to basketball games. It’s a fun way to spend your free time and you can win big prizes if you bet well.

Getting a sportsbook up and running isn’t easy. It takes time and effort to build an efficient product that will attract customers and keep them happy. To make a successful sportsbook, you need to have a solid strategy and a team of experts who can implement it effectively.

To maximize your sportsbook’s profits, you should consider offering a wide range of betting markets and making the experience as easy as possible for your customers. For example, you should include ante-post betting markets for different leagues as well as ATP and WTA tours. In addition to this, you should offer odds for popular sporting events like the World Cup and the Olympic Games. You should also consider adding a live streaming option for some of the events to improve the customer experience. This will increase your profits and reduce customer complaints.